The Commission also ordered all operating payment systems including Flutterwave, Opay, Paystack and Monify to immediately...

has ordered Google Play Store to pull down four money lending companies for “escalating unethical, obnoxious and unscrupulously exploitative practices in the industry.”

to tackle “possible violation” of consumer rights where at least seven loan companies including Soko Loan were raided.The commission’s boss said that some lending companies including Soko Loan who have been subject of investigation “have devised methods to leverage on technology and other financial services alternatives to circumvent account freezing and app suspension Orders.

“For apps not on the Play Store, the Commission continues to trace what platforms they are hosted on in order to disable them; the Commission invites any information from the public in this regard.” “The Commission has also ordered telecommunication/ technology companies ) to cease and desist providing server/hosting or other key services such as connectivity to disclosed or known lenders who are targets/subjects of investigation or otherwise operating without regulatory approval,” the statement reads.
